National Earnings
The earnings information below is for the occupational group Plant and System Operators, All Other. The occupation Biofuels Processing Technician is part of this group.
Note: variations in salaries reflect differences in size of firm, location, level of education and professional credentials.

Industries
|
Large concentrations of this occupation are found in these industries
- Manufacturing (NAICS31-330) (40.8%)
- Federal government (NAICS910000) (13.3%)
- Nonmetallic mineral product manufacturing (NAICS327000) (12.7%)
- Mining, Quarrying, and Oil and Gas Extraction (NAICS210000) (11%)
- Petroleum and coal products manufacturing (NAICS324000) (10.7%)
- Mining (except oil and gas) (NAICS212000) (9.8%)
- Chemical manufacturing (NAICS325000) (8.6%)
- Nonmetallic mineral mining and quarrying (NAICS212300) (7.5%)
- Construction (NAICS230000) (7.3%)
- Wholesale trade (NAICS420000) (6.5%)
- Local government, excluding education and hospitals (6.3%)
